SACRAMENTO – Lucy Milliner turned in a top-50 finish to lead the Hawai'i cross country team in its NCAA West Regional appearance Friday morning in Sacramento.
The Rainbow Wahine placed 29th overall as a team with 810 points in the final race of the 2025 season.
Milliner crossed the line with a 6k season best time of 20:43.6, finishing 43rd to become the first UH runner to crack the top 50 at an NCAA Regional since 2016 (Camille Campos). The sophomore climbed up the pack throughout the race, jumping up 18 spots after sitting in 61st place through the first mile to post the best 6k time of the season for the Rainbow Wahine.
Lucy Becker stopped the clock in 22:05.0 to come in 129th, improving upon her Big West Championship time while placing in the UH top four for the sixth time in six meets this year.
Zola O'Donnell posted a time of 22:48.9 to finish 191st and has finished in the team top three in all six meets this year.
